KELTAN® Eco 5470

Technical Datasheet | Supplied by ARLANXEO
KELTAN® Eco 5470 by ARLANXEO is a highly crystalline, 70% bio-based ethylene propylene diene rubber (EPDM) with narrow molecular weight distribution and medium Mooney viscosity. It is made with ethylene from sugarcane. It contains medium ethylidene norbornene (ENB) content and a non-staining stabilizer. It is compatible with other synthetic rubbers. It exhibits reduced dependence on fossil resources and reduced carbon footprint, outstanding flexibility, elasticity and heat stability. It offers good weather resistance, durability, great surface aesthetics, excellent electrical properties and moldability. It provides very high mechanical strength, good robustness and good processability. It can be processed by extrusion. KELTAN® Eco 5470 is recommended for solid sealing systems, hoses, mechanical goods and low voltage cable applications.

KELTAN® Eco 5470 Properties

Physical Properties

Value & Unit
Test Condition
Test Method
Mooney Viscosity
55 MU
(ML (1+4) 125°C) 
ISO 289
Ethylene Content
70 %wt
ASTM D3900
Ethylidene norbornene (ENB) Content
4.6 %wt
ASTM D6047
